Andreas Lügering is a scholar working on Immunology, Epidemiology and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Andreas Lügering has authored 58 papers receiving a total of 2.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Immunology, 22 papers in Epidemiology and 22 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Andreas Lügering's work include Inflammatory Bowel Disease (19 papers), Microscopic Colitis (14 papers) and Immune Response and Inflammation (10 papers). Andreas Lügering is often cited by papers focused on Inflammatory Bowel Disease (19 papers), Microscopic Colitis (14 papers) and Immune Response and Inflammation (10 papers). Andreas Lügering coll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Croatia. Andreas Lügering's co-authors include Torsten Kucharzik, Norbert Lügering, W Domschke, Michael Schmidt, Hans‐Gerd Pauels, Wolfram Domschke, Jan Heidemann, Christian Maaser, Klaus Schulze‐Osthoff and Christopher Poremba and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Immunology, Gastroenterology and Hepatology.
